Options after GATE COAP seat allotment under round 3
Candidates can exercise different options after GATE COAP seat allotment as explained below.
Option 1- 'Accept and Freeze': Candidates willing to accept the seat allotted under GATE COAP round 3 have to select this option. Candidates selecting this option will not be considered in the subsequent rounds of admission in any of the participating institutes.
Option 2- 'Retain and Wait': If a candidate accepts the seat allotted to him/her but wants to be considered for upgrading in the subsequent round of offers, they have to select this option. Candidates selecting this option will not be considered for the other rejected offers in the current round. However, if any higher preferred offer is made in the next round then the existing 'Retain and Wait' offer will be released. Also, a candidate can choose "Retain and Wait" on the same institute and same programme only twice.
Option 3- 'Reject and Wait': If a candidate is not willing to accept any of the allotted seats in GATE COAP round 3 allotment, he/she should choose this option. Such candidates will be considered for other higher preferences, if any, in the subsequent rounds of admission offered in any participating academic Institutes.
A total of five GATE COAP seat allotment rounds are being conducted for candidates. In addition to these, additional 5 rounds will also be conducted. Till now, the authorities have conducted round 1 and round 2 of GATE COAP seat allotment and round 3 is available till June 13.

COAP is a portal that provides a common platform for the registered GATE qualified candidates to make the most preferred choice for admission into an MTech programmes in the participating institutes.
